			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p class="first-child "><span title="P" class="cap"><span>P</span></span>anama is divided into nine provinces (Spanish: provincias) and three provinciallevel indigenous regions (Spanish: comarcas indígenas, often foreshortened to comarcas). There are two further comarcas within provinces that are considered equivalent to a corregimiento (municipality).<br />
The nine provinces are:<br />
